Granlund strengthening its presence in Southeast Asia

More than 130 chief engineers, key suppliers and partners engaged in the Malaysian hotel industry attended the 2018 Malaysia Hotel Engineering Association Exhibition in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ia on April 20, 2018.

The one-day exhibition arranged by the Malaysia Hotel Engineering Association in Kuala Lumpur brought together a variety of local and international stakeholders in the Malaysian hotel industry for networking and sharing engineering best practices, new technologies and environmental issues.

Granlund set up an exhibition booth with the aims of strengthening its presence in the Southeast Asia region and promoting the Granlund Manager software.

“There was great interest in Granlund and our offering, and the outcome of the event was very successful. We were able to establish several new potential customers and partners in the hotel business in Malaysia, and continue discussions with them in the months ahead,“ said David Leff-Hallstein, Sales Director, Granlund China. 

“We also met a couple of potential lead partners and value-added resellers, who showed great interest in becoming our partners. With the help from local partners we are able to increase our presence and activities in the region,” Leff-Hallstein continued.

The exhibition reaffirmed that many hotels are at this time looking for property management software such as Granlund Manager to make their maintenance process more efficient by switching from a paper-based models to a digital, cloud-based solutions.

“Looking from Granlund Manager´s perspective, I have a very positive outlook for Malaysia and the overall Southeast Asia region,” added Leff-Hallstein.
